Christopher
Wajda, born in 1972 in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, graduated
from Holy Ghost Preparatory School in Bensalem, PA before attending
art
school and later studying art and design at the university level
in Philadelphia.
Wajda began working in illustration in 1994 for the Trenton Times, New Jersey's largest daily newspaper producing half and three quarter page full color
illustrations. Wajda also produced humorous illustration and graphic design for
a wide array of businesses and organizations, from book illustration to safety
and business cartoons for trade journals. Gradually, developing websites and
industrial design grew from the exposure of those first illustrations leading
to the opening of Bucks County's NorthPoint Studios in 2001.
Christopher Wajda has won many awards and juried competitions for his graphic
design and Illustration. His graphic design and fine art has been featured in
regional and national venues and in 2002 he began providing commissioned pieces
for private collections. During 2003, he shifted focus from the industrial and graphic design
arts to fine arts, primarily illustration and pursuing a path more geared to
the exploration of color, form and the integration of design expressed in a variety
of painting mediums. Wajda spent 6 years traveling extensively through Eastern and Western Europe
and North America studying different artistic techniques and studying the works
of the European and modern American masters. Currently, Wajda's fine art is represented
by Bucks County's NorthPoint Gallery, bringing his work to the community in Philadelphia,
Bucks County and surrounding areas. |
